HOWTO: Caching Kit in SWG version 10.x

Expand / Collapse


This article applies to:

  • SWG 10.x
  • Caching Kit 

Question:

  • Do I have to do a clean re-install if a caching kit is retrofitted (as stated in the Caching Kit Tech Brief, article Q-13660)?
  • What is the procedure to install a Caching Kit?

Procedure:

With SWG version 10.0, a clean installation is no longer required.

Save your configuration by performing a 'Rollback Backup'. Power off the appliance (Limited shell command 'poweroff') and insert hard disk and RAM (if relevant). Then power up the appliance and login to the limited shell (SSH).

1. Run the command 'config_hardware'. It will show that the hardware is installed, but not yet configured.

2. The next step depends on appliance role:

2.1 On an All-in-one appliance, run the 'setup' command on the limited shell again. It should not be necessary to type all details again, simply confirm each step with [enter]. After setup is completed, some background processes are performed in order to update the configuration.

2.2 If a Scanning appliance (SWG x100) has been upgraded, login to the GUI, navigate to 'M86 Devices' and remove and add the scanner. Enable caching, if not done already.
